CondaHTTPError: HTTP 000 CONNECTION FAILED
时间: 2023-11-01 17:52:39 浏览: 53
CondaHTTPError: HTTP 000 CONNECTION FAILED是一个与连接相关的错误,当尝试从特定的URL获取数据时发生。这个错误通常与网络连接问题有关,可能是由于网络不稳定、防火墙设置、被阻止的URL等原因引起的。在这种情况下,可以尝试以下解决方法:
1. 检查网络连接: 请确保您的计算机与互联网连接正常,并且没有任何网络问题。
2. 检查防火墙设置: 某些防火墙设置可能会阻止与特定URL的连接。请确保防火墙没有阻止与Anaconda相关的URL。您可以尝试关闭防火墙或者将Anaconda相关的URL添加到防火墙的白名单中。
3. 检查URL是否被阻止: 如果您的网络环境中存在URL屏蔽或过滤器,可能会导致连接失败。在这种情况下,建议您联系网络工程团队并请求他们解除对Anaconda相关URL的阻止。
4. 尝试使用其他镜像源: 如果您使用的是默认的Anaconda镜像源,可以尝试切换到其他镜像源,例如清华镜像源或者使用代理服务器。这些镜像源通常具有更好的稳定性和更快的下载速度。
请根据具体情况尝试以上解决方法,以解决CondaHTTPError: HTTP 000 CONNECTION FAILED错误。
相关问题
CondaHTTPError: HTTP 000 CONNECTION FAILED for url
CondaHTTPError: HTTP 000 CONNECTION FAILED for url 是Anaconda在创建新环境或导入包的过程中遇到的错误。这个错误表示在尝试从URL检索数据时出现了HTTP错误。根据引用、和,这个错误可能与网络连接问题有关,可能是由于URL无法访问或配置问题导致的。要解决这个问题,可以尝试以下步骤:
1. 检查网络连接: 确保你的计算机已连接到互联网,并且网络连接是正常的。可以尝试打开浏览器并访问其他网站来确认网络是否正常工作。
2. 检查URL的可访问性: 确保你使用的URL是正确的,并且可以在浏览器中访问。有时候,URL可能会发生变化或不可用,导致无法访问。
3. 更换镜像源: 引用中提到了清华源的问题,你可以尝试更换镜像源。可以使用conda config命令来更改Anaconda的镜像源为其他可用的镜像源,比如使用conda config --add channels conda-forge命令添加conda-forge的镜像源。
4. 检查代理设置: 如果你使用代理服务器进行网络连接,确保你的代理设置正确,并且能够与Anaconda服务器进行通信。
5. 更新Anaconda: 确保你的Anaconda版本是最新的,可以使用conda update conda和conda update anaconda命令来更新Anaconda。
以上是一些常见的解决步骤,你可以根据具体情况尝试其中的一些方法来解决CondaHTTPError: HTTP 000 CONNECTION FAILED for url 错误。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[一直Solving enviroment 最后报错CondaHTTPError: HTTP 000 CONNECTION FAILED for url](https://download.csdn.net/download/weixin_38503448/14037142)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[conda配置+出现CondaHTTPError: HTTP 000 CONNECTION FAILED for url ...的终极解决方法](https://blog.csdn.net/qq_52897088/article/details/122798949)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[解决CondaHTTPError:HTTP 000 CONNECTION FAILED for url<https://mirrors.tuna.tsinghua.edu.cn/anaconda...](https://blog.csdn.net/weixin_51484460/article/details/122179000)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
condahttperror: http 000 connection failed for url
Conda是Python的一个常用的包管理器,可以方便地安装和管理各种Python模块。在使用Conda进行包管理时,有时会出现"condahttperror: http 000 connection failed for url"的错误提示。这个错误提示意味着Conda无法连接到指定的URL进行操作。
这种错误通常是因为网络或者代理的问题引起的。首先,我们需要确保我们的网络连接良好,并且可以访问指定的URL。我们可以通过使用浏览器或者curl命令来测试URL是否可用。
如果网络连接正常,但是Conda仍然无法连接到URL,那么可能是代理服务器导致了错误。需要在终端输入以下命令:
- Windows系统:
set HTTPS_PROXY=http://proxy.server:port
set HTTP_PROXY=http://proxy.server:port
- Linux和Mac系统:
export HTTP_PROXY=http://proxy.server:port
export HTTPS_PROXY=https://proxy.server:port
其中,proxy.server是代理服务器的名称或者IP地址,port是端口号。
如果还是无法解决问题,那么可能是因为安装的Conda库版本过旧导致的。我们可以通过在终端输入以下命令来更新Conda:
conda update --all
这个命令将会更新所有已安装的Conda库。
总之,"condahttperror: http 000 connection failed for url"的错误提示意味着Conda无法连接到指定的URL进行操作。可以通过检查网络连接、代理服务器、或更新Conda等方式来解决问题。